Oba of Benin

The ruler of the kingdom of Benin were called " Oba " and reigned from 1200 AD, the Kingdom of Benin in Nigeria today. From the 15th to the 19th century, this was one of the mightiest empire in West Africa. The original rulers of the present city of Benin ruled between 800 and 1200 little more than the city and a few dependent villages. They are usually grouped together as " Ogiso Dynasty " and can hardly be regarded as the ruler of a kingdom. After the end of this dynasty was followed by a ruler named Oranyim.
